How many MPG does a Chevy Sonic get?

How many MPG does a Chevy Sonic get?

With the manual, you can expect an EPA-estimated 35 mpg highway and 26 mpg city, while the automatic transmission will get you an EPA-estimated 35 mpg highway and 24 mpg city.

Is the Chevrolet Sonic a good used car?

The 2019 Chevrolet Sonic ranks near the top of our used subcompact car class. It offers a spacious cabin, athletic handling, and an excellent reliability rating. However, a lack of basic standard features, an underpowered engine, and so-so fuel economy ratings hold the Sonic back.

Is Chevy Sonic fast?

For starters, the 138-hp six-speed manual Sonic LTZ Turbo is easily the quickest subcompact by a healthy margin. Chevy estimates the turbocharged LTZ will run to 60 mph in 8.2 seconds — about a second quicker than a 120-hp Fiesta or 117-hp Fit.

How many miles can I get out of a Chevy Sonic?

Multiple mileage reports suggest the Chevrolet Sonic can last for 150,000 to 200,000 miles. If you drive like every other American (15,000 miles annually), your new Chevrolet Sonic can run for 10-13 years. This shows the Sonic is a relatively well-built vehicle that will serve you for long.

Why did Chevy stop making Sonic?

GM decided to axe the Sonic “due to declining demand,” according to Soule. Since selling nearly 100,000 Sonics in 2014, sales have declined every year by between 15% to more than %. GM sold less than 14,000 of the cars last year.

What will replace the Chevy Sonic?

GM discontinues Chevrolet Sonic amid dismal sales and push toward EVs. Production of the Sonic at GM’s Orion Assembly in suburban Detroit will end in October. It will be replaced by a new all-electric vehicle called the Bolt EUV in 2021.

What is the fuel economy of a Chevy Sonic?

With the 138-horsepower 1.8L I4 engine, 6-speed shiftable automatic transmission, and front-wheel drive, the 2018 Chevrolet Sonic has been averaging 31.62 MPG (miles per gallon). The 2018 Chevrolet Sonics in this analysis were driven mostly on the highway at an average speed of 60 miles per hour (about 41.3 percent of the miles driven). The rest of the miles were in the city (38.8 percent), in heavy traffic (0.1 percent), and in the suburbs (0 percent).
